刷题刷出新高度,偷偷领先!偷偷领先!偷偷领先! 关注我们,悄悄成为最优秀的自己!

面试题

请展示您编写使用Java数据库连接(JDBC)连接Oracle数据库的程序的能力。请描述您如何建立连接,执行查询并关闭连接。

使用微信搜索喵呜刷题,轻松应对面试!

答案:

解答思路:

要编写一个使用JDBC连接Oracle的程序,你需要了解JDBC(Java数据库连接)的基本概念和Oracle数据库的基本操作。以下是一个基本的步骤和代码示例。

最优回答:

以下是一个简单的JDBC连接Oracle数据库的程序示例:

import java.sql.*;

public class OracleJDBCExample {
    public static void main(String[] args) {
        Connection conn = null;
        Statement stmt = null;
        ResultSet rs = null;
        try {
            // 注册Oracle JDBC驱动
            Class.forName("oracle.jdbc.driver.OracleDriver");
            // 打开连接
            String url = "jdbc:oracle:thin:@localhost:1521:ORCL"; // 请根据实际情况替换ORCL为你的Oracle服务名或SID
            String user = "yourUsername"; // 你的数据库用户名
            String password = "yourPassword"; // 你的数据库密码
            conn = DriverManager.getConnection(url, user, password);
            // 执行查询语句
            String sql = "SELECT * FROM yourTable"; // 请替换为你的查询语句和表名
            stmt = conn.createStatement();
            rs = stmt.executeQuery(sql);
            // 处理结果集...(此处省略)
        } catch (SQLException se) {
            se.printStackTrace(); // 处理异常...(此处省略)
        } catch (Exception e) {
            e.printStackTrace(); // 处理其他异常...(此处省略)
        } finally {
            // 关闭资源...(此处省略)
        }
    }
}

请注意替换代码中的数据库URL、用户名、密码和查询语句为你的实际信息。同时,确保你的Java环境中已经包含了Oracle的JDBC驱动。此外,对于异常处理和资源关闭部分,你需要根据实际情况进行完善。这只是一个基本的示例,实际应用中可能需要更复杂的逻辑和错误处理。

解析:

JDBC是Java中用于连接和操作数据库的标准API。Oracle JDBC驱动允许Java应用程序连接到Oracle数据库并执行SQL查询。在编写JDBC程序时,你需要了解以下内容:数据库连接URL的格式、如何注册JDBC驱动、如何执行SQL查询和如何处理结果集等。此外,还需要了解异常处理和资源关闭的重要性,以确保程序的稳定性和安全性。在实际应用中,你可能还需要考虑连接池、事务管理和安全性等方面的知识。
创作类型:
原创

本文链接:请展示您编写使用Java数据库连接(JDBC)连接Oracle数据库的程序的能力。请描述您如何建立连

版权声明:本站点所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明文章出处。

让学习像火箭一样快速,微信扫码,获取考试解析、体验刷题服务,开启你的学习加速器!

分享考题
share